    Quality of Life organizational members from the 21st Theater Sustainment Command, G1 Army Morale, Welfare, and Recreation, American Red Cross, Army and Air Force Exchange Service, Stars and Stripes, USO and two 21st TSC employees take a group photo after being recognized by U.S. Army Maj. Gen. James Smith, commanding general, 21st TSC, at Panzer Kaserne, Kaiserslautern, Germany, October 17, 2022.

    Over the last year, the organizations have directly supported over 30,000 Service Members, thousands of Afghan travelers and those affected from the Ukraine Crises during Operation Allies Refuge, Operation Allies Welcome, and Operation European Assure, Deter and Reinforce. Quality of Life programs ensure the Army’s people are the No. 1 priority by enriching their lives by means of safety, health, and well-being and reducing stress and uncertainty while increasing Army readiness.
